Significance: This study suggests that DUBA, by decreasing the expression of its target gene, it may suppress the expression of MDM2. Thereby, it may promote the stability of tumor suppressor p53 and inhibit tumorigenesis. Thus, pharmacological formulations encompassing “DUBA activators“ may be used to inhibit the proliferation of cancer cells.
